TURN-208: Gatevale turnstile counters at the Merrow Field pilot double-count when a rotation reverses mid-cycle. Attendance totals drift roughly 2% high per event. The debounce window fix is implemented, reviewed by Ilsa, and soak-tested across two simulated match days without drift. Ready for your cut; the candidate build is identified below.

trace token, tagag-tafog: htk6_5ed18c

### Migration Step 4: Undo/Redo Hooks

In Sketchline 3, the undo stack is no longer a global singleton. Plugins must register undoable actions through the new transaction API; direct stack mutation is ignored and logged. Batch your edits into a single transaction, or each keystroke becomes its own undo step, which users will notice immediately. The host editor exposes its history limits to plugins at load time, and the defaults it ships with are shown here.

deployment values, taduf-fawig:
WENAEL_HOST=wenael.zemvarlabs.internal
WENAEL_PORT=8443

TICKET-4182: DocLint misconfigured on staging-east. The linter for the Marrowfield docs pipeline is pointing at the prod rules bundle, so every PR fails vocabulary checks. Root cause: staging env file was copied from Quilla's prod template without scrubbing. Fix is to regenerate the staging env and rotate the rules-fetch credential. Owner: Tobbe. ETA Friday. The corrected env file should include the following line.

vault entry, kafog-yahop: COURIER_KEY8=0faa53ae

// MAX_BOUNCE_RETRIES controls how many times the Mailwick bounce
// processor re-queues a soft bounce before flagging the address as
// suppressed. Support: if a customer reports missing receipts, check
// whether their address crossed this threshold during the Fernhollow
// outage window. Raising this value requires sign-off from the
// deliverability group, since it directly affects our sender score
// with upstream relays. When escalating, always include the processor
// build token shown below.

pipeline stamp: htk9_ce63042d9